Abstract

The invention relates to diagnosis, detection, screening, identifying and predicting methods. In various embodiments, methods of the invention include diagnosis, detection, or screening for a hyperproliferative disorder (e.g., a tumor, cancer or neoplasia) in the subject; identifying a subject that will or is likely to respond to a therapy for a hyperproliferative disorder (e.g., a tumor, cancer or neoplasia); and predicting therapeutic efficacy of a hyperproliferative disorder (e.g., a tumor, cancer or neoplasia) treatment in a subject.

Claims (22)

1. A method of analyzing a pancreatic, hepatic, melanoma, kidney, gastrointestinal, lung, lymphoma or leukemia sample, the method comprising:

(a) contacting the pancreatic, hepatic, melanoma, kidney, gastrointestinal, lung, lymphoma or leukemia sample from a subject, with a hormone polypeptide or hormone polypeptide analog that binds to LHRH- or hCG/LH receptors under conditions allowing the hormone or hormone analog to bind the LHRH- or hCG/LH receptors;

(b) determining an amount of LHRH- or hCG/LH receptors in the sample by detecting the amount of hormone polypeptide or hormone polypeptide analog that is bound to the LHRH- or hCG/LH receptors in the sample;

(c) contacting cells obtained from the sample with a peptide comprising the cytotoxic sequence KFAKFAKKFAKFAKKFAKQHWSYGLRPG (SEQ ID NO: 1); and

(d) after the contacting of (c), determining the IC50 value according to a sensitivity of the cells to SEQ ID NO:1, wherein the IC50 value is 5.5 μM or less and wherein greater LHRH- or hCG/LH receptor expression indicates increased sensitivity of the cells.

2. The method of claim 1 , comprising identifying a sample according to the determining of (b), wherein greater than 50% of the cells express LHRH- or hCG/LH receptors.

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the cytotoxic sequence is biotin-conjugated or fluorescein conjugated.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the hormone polypeptide or hormone polypeptide analog comprises one or more D-amino acids.

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the hormone polypeptide or hormone polypeptide analog is biotin-conjugated or fluorescein-conjugated.
